Load test — Tillbox checkout. Run staging only. Ramp: 50 to 500 VUs over 10 min, hold 15. Watch payment-stub latency and cart-lock contention; abort if error rate passes 2%. Reset fixtures after every run or subsequent tests pollute inventory counts. Never point the harness at prod endpoints. Full runbook with thresholds and abort steps lives here:

runbook for badug-kadup: https://confluence.zemvarlabs.internal/projects/browse/display/projects/bd1b

Ticket #918 — Sig check failing on planner hotfix

Hey — the hotfix for the Quellbase query planner regression won't pass verification; CI says the bundle was signed with a stale key after last week's rotation. Can you re-review the pipeline patch? To reproduce locally you'll need the current signing key, pasted below.

rollout seal: bky4_x7Gc

Finance Review Summary — Reseller Programme

The Lanward reseller programme delivered a 12% uplift in indirect revenue this half, though rebate costs ran slightly above forecast. Margin per partner varies considerably by region, and we recommend branch managers review tier assignments before renewal season. Onboarding costs have stabilised. A confidential note on forward plans for the programme appears directly below.

internal memo for kaduf-baduf: Only 35 of the 378 pilot accounts renewed Holir, so a churn review is set for June 11. Eliielax Group is in early talks to buy Silaelix Group for about $142.1 million.

Ticket: Turnstile counter outage at Harrowfield Arena

The Gatecount turnstile counter stopped reporting because its credential to the internal Tallyroom ingest service expired silently. Future maintainers: rotation is manual and due every 90 days; add a calendar reminder. The replacement key for the Tallyroom ingest endpoint is provided below.

API key for kahop-bagef: zpat2_yb